1 TMs FAOH transcript interview with Consul General Earl Packer by Paul D. McCusker, with discussion of Petrograd, Soviet Union -Military Mission (1917-1919); Russian Affairs (1918-22); Riga/Tallinn, Soviet Union (1922-25); Eastern European Affairs (1925-35); Riga, Soviet Union (1936-40); Budapest, Hungary (1940-41); Dublin, Ireland (1942-44); Turkey (1944-46); Rangoon, Burma (1946-47); and Tunis, Tunisia (1947).
